What cut of beef is best for sausage?

Chuck is a common beef cut for sausage making and comes from the cows neck, shoulder, and parts of the ribs. At 15-20% fat, it as a relatively high fat content for beef. A combination of Brisket (point end) and Chuck is a good combination.

What is the most important ingredient in sausage?

Salt
  • Salt is the most critical ingredient in sausage manufacturing.
  • Without salt sausages cannot be made.
  • Salt has 3 primary functions – preservation, flavour enhancement and protein extraction to create the product to bind.
  • Most sausages have 2-3 % of added salt.

Is homemade sausage safe?

That is exactly what happens when meats (especially sausages) are slow smoked. Clostridium bacteria are easily killed when cooked. Even if they are allowed to grow, the toxin which causes botulism is easily destroyed by cooking to 176° F (80°C).

What kind of sausage is not processed?

Fresh or raw sausage: ground meat, fat, and spices that have been mixed but not cured or cooked (the meat is still raw). It’s typically sold in casings, but you can also buy fresh sausage meat in patties or just loose like any other ground meat.

Can raw beef sausages make you sick?

Raw meat may contain harmful bacteria including Salmonella, Listeria, Campylobacter and E. coli that can cause food poisoning. These bacteria are destroyed when meat is correctly cooked.
